Transaction ed998060af8358963bcaf8fa338631c4b7966dbd53b72273219cfcc05f06f333
1 Input
1 Output
-
ed998060af8358963bcaf8fa338631c4b7966dbd53b72273219cfcc05f06f333:0
- value
- 137802531
- script pubkey
- OP_0 OP_PUSHBYTES_20 09d216e3c2647c5b61e243a3fbb11b7216871d1c
- address
- bc1qp8fpdc7zv379kc0zgw3lhvgmwgtgw8gueg0cyy